Westinghouse, Nordion, and PSEG team up to produce Co‑60 in the United States
This past January, Westinghouse Electric Company, Nordion, and PSEG Nuclear formalized agreements to implement newly developed cobalt-60 production technology at Units 1 and 2 of PSEG’s Salem nuclear power plant in New Jersey, with the Co-60 to be supplied to Nordion. Through an ongoing joint initiative, the companies aim to harness U.S. pressurized water reactors to produce a key medical isotope and build the first commercial-scale Co-60 production platform in the United States.
